网站首页 > 厂商资讯 > 环信 > Java如何实现微信小程序视频播放? 在当今这个信息爆炸的时代,视频已经成为我们获取信息、娱乐休闲的重要方式。随着微信小程序的普及,越来越多的人开始关注如何在微信小程序中实现视频播放。本文将详细介绍Java如何实现微信小程序视频播放,包括所需技术、实现步骤以及注意事项。 一、所需技术 1. Java开发环境:如Eclipse、IntelliJ IDEA等。 2. 小程序开发框架:如uni-app、WePY等。 3. 视频播放库:如ijkplayer、ExoPlayer等。 4. 微信小程序开发工具:微信开发者工具。 二、实现步骤 1. 创建小程序项目 首先,使用微信开发者工具创建一个新的小程序项目。在项目创建过程中,选择合适的框架,如uni-app或WePY。 2. 引入视频播放库 在项目中引入视频播放库,这里以ijkplayer为例。首先,在项目的根目录下创建一个名为“libs”的文件夹,然后将ijkplayer的jar包放入该文件夹中。接下来,在项目的build.gradle文件中添加以下代码: ``` dependencies { implementation files('libs/ijkplayer.jar') } ``` 3. 创建视频播放页面 在项目中创建一个新的页面,用于展示视频播放功能。在页面的json配置文件中,设置页面的路径和窗口背景色等属性。 4. 添加视频播放组件 在页面的wxml文件中,添加视频播放组件。以uni-app为例,代码如下: ``` ``` 5. 设置视频播放地址 在页面的js文件中,设置视频播放地址。以uni-app为例,代码如下: ``` Page({ data: { videoUrl: 'http://example.com/video.mp4' } }); ``` 6. 测试视频播放 在微信开发者工具中预览页面,查看视频是否可以正常播放。如果播放异常,请检查视频地址是否正确,以及网络环境是否良好。 7. 优化视频播放性能 为了提高视频播放性能,可以对视频进行解码优化。以下是一些优化方法: (1)调整视频分辨率:根据用户设备性能和屏幕尺寸,选择合适的视频分辨率。 (2)开启硬件加速:在视频播放组件中,开启硬件加速功能。 (3)调整播放速度:根据用户需求,调整视频播放速度。 三、注意事项 1. 视频格式:微信小程序支持多种视频格式,如mp4、webm等。请确保视频格式正确,以免播放失败。 2. 视频大小:视频大小应控制在合理范围内,以免影响小程序性能。 3. 网络环境:在视频播放过程中,请确保用户处于良好的网络环境下,以免出现卡顿现象。 4. 权限申请:根据小程序的权限要求,申请相应的权限,如存储、网络等。 5. 错误处理:在视频播放过程中,可能遇到各种异常情况,如网络中断、视频损坏等。请添加相应的错误处理机制,提高用户体验。 总之,Java实现微信小程序视频播放需要掌握相关技术,了解实现步骤,并注意细节。通过本文的介绍,相信您已经对Java实现微信小程序视频播放有了较为全面的了解。在实际开发过程中,不断优化和调整,使视频播放功能更加完善。 猜你喜欢:IM出海